Economy & Jobs
The median household income in Lac Baker is $69,000, roughly in line with the national average of $75,149. At 8.5%, unemployment is notably high. 11.6% of residents live in poverty, near the national average of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 34 minutes.
Cost of Living & Housing
The median home value in Lac Baker is $125,000, 56%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. At just 1.8x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.
Education
6.5%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 24.2% have completed high school.
Lac Baker has a population of 685 with a density of 48 people per square mile. The median age is 58.8 years, 51% older than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(100%).
